What it does

The chat box on your website and the text thread after a missed call are the same agent, trained on the same information. It answers the question, checks your live calendar and books the job. It is not a contact form wearing a chat skin, and it does not demand an email address before it will say anything useful.

The reason it matters is timing. A caller who reaches voicemail usually does not leave one, and a visitor who fills in a form has already opened three other tabs. A reply that arrives while they are still in the parking lot, or still on the page, keeps the conversation on your side. Whatever your average job is worth, the arithmetic on recovering a few of those a month is not complicated.

Setup and go-live

Most builds go live in about a week to ten days. We take your common questions, pricing rules, hours and hand-off rules first, on a call or on site depending on how involved it is, enable texting on your existing number, and drop the chat script on your site. Then we run test threads with you watching before either channel touches a real customer.

Frequently asked questions

What is missed-call text back?

When a call to your business rings out, the system texts that number within seconds and then holds the conversation by text. The caller does not have to ring you back, and you do not have to hope they left a voicemail.

How much does website chat cost?

Plans start at $395 a month, flat, covering the phone line, website chat, missed-call text back and calendar booking. No setup fee, no per-message charge, month to month. What it runs for your business is set in the free fifteen-minute audit, before any work starts.

Will it quote my real prices?

Only if you want it to. We train it on your service list and your pricing rules, and you decide whether it gives a figure, gives a range, or says a person will confirm. It does not guess at a number.

What if someone asks something it does not know?

It stops and hands off rather than guessing. The thread goes to your cell if you are available, or it takes a callback request that lands in your inbox with the messages attached.

Will it text people who did not ask for a text?

It replies once, to the number that just called you, and every message carries an opt-out. If they reply STOP it stops immediately and the number is flagged so nothing goes out again.

Can the chat book straight into my calendar?

Yes, into the calendar or job board you already use, or anything that takes a webhook. It reads live availability before it offers a slot, so it cannot book a time you are already on a job.
